The Bartender Tipped position at the Alliant Energy Center, under Sodexo Live's operation, offers a flexible part-time employment opportunity with an hourly pay range of $15.00 to $18.00. This role is ideal for individuals passionate about customer service and beverage preparation, seeking a dynamic work environment that includes varying shifts across days, evenings, weekends, and holidays. As a bartender, you will play an essential role in creating enjoyable experiences for guests by mixing and serving drinks efficiently and with a friendly demeanor.

In this role, you will work closely with wait staff and other team members to ensure timely and quality service. The responsibilities include greeting guests, crafting both al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ages, and maintaining a well-stocked and organized bar area. You will be required to manage inventory, prepare accurate counts, and collaborate with the wider team to keep supplies replenished. Physical requirements include standing or walking for extended periods, lifting moderate weights, and performing repetitive tasks.

Sodexo Live values employees who can demonstrate tact, attentiveness, and a positive attitude while working in fast-paced settings. Your ability to make a broad range of drink recipes correctly is preferred, and you must comply with all legal requirements concerning alcohol service. Job Requirements

  • Must be at or over the minimum age to serve alcohol or bartend according to local regulations
  • ability to stand or walk throughout shift durations which may exceed 8 hours
  • capability to reach, bend, stoop, push, pull, and lift up to 50 pounds
  • ability to perform repetitive movements
  • punctuality and regular attendance for scheduled shifts

Job Qualifications

  • High school diploma, GED, or equivalent experience
  • 0 to 1 year related experience preferred
  • ability to make a wide range of drink recipes and mix drinks correctly
  • knowledge of local alcohol service laws and age requirements
  • strong interpersonal skills and customer service orientation

Job Duties

  • Greet guests, mix and serve alcoholic/non-alcoholic drinks with appropriate garnishes
  • ensure the bar area is fully equipped with necessary tools and products
  • prepare accurate beginning counts and manage inventory requisitions
  • work collaboratively with wait staff to provide prompt service
  • maintain friendliness, tact, and attentiveness while interacting with customers
  • perform significant walking and standing for extended periods
  • lift and move weights up to 50 pounds as required
